The Three Decay Zones
Green Zone: Immediate Engagement (0-30 Days)
Actively participate in agricultural technology forums, sustainable energy conferences, and 'Agri-Tech' meetups. Share insights on upstream energy processes relevant to farming (e.g., precision irrigation energy demands, bio-product refinement). Seek collaborative opportunities with agricultural engineers, agronomists, and farm managers on energy-efficient projects. Offer to present on energy optimization for agricultural operations. Directly contribute to online discussions regarding sustainable agriculture and energy use.
Yellow Zone: Re-ignition Required (30-90 Days)
Re-engage by sharing relevant industry articles or research papers on energy-efficient agricultural practices or biofuel development that directly relate to their work. Initiate 'coffee chat' calls to discuss how your petroleum engineering expertise could address specific energy challenges they're facing in agriculture (e.g., optimizing energy for greenhouse operations, water pumping). Offer to introduce them to contacts in the energy sector who might benefit their agricultural endeavors, demonstrating a synergistic approach.

Red Zone: Relationship Recovery (90+ Days)
Send a personalized message acknowledging a recent achievement or development in their agricultural organization, linking it back to a potential energy or resource efficiency angle. Propose a brief virtual session to brainstorm innovative energy solutions for their long-term agricultural sustainability goals, emphasizing a forward-looking, problem-solving approach. Highlight your commitment to fostering cross-industry collaboration and learning.

High-Value Reciprocity Angle
Offer unique insights on industrial-scale energy efficiency, resource extraction, and chemical processing relevant to agricultural waste-to-energy, bio-product refinement, or precision farming's energy needs. Connect agricultural professionals with energy experts for sustainable solutions. Share data-driven methodologies for optimizing complex systems, transferable from oil & gas to farm management. Your value lies in translating fundamental energy principles into actionable agricultural improvements.
